gpt4 book ai didi

javascript - Underscore.js - 获取唯一的属性值

转载 作者:可可西里 更新时间:2023-11-01 01:45:26 25 4
gpt4 key购买 nike

我最近才发现 underscore.js 的强大功能,对方法还是很陌生,恳请大家提个建议:

我如何从中得到:

[
[{
"name": "Type 2",
"id": 14
}],
[{
"name": "Type 1",
"id": 13
}, {
"name": "Type 3",
"id": 15
}],
[{
"name": "Type 2",
"id": 14
}],
[{
"name": "Type 1",
"id": 13
}]
]

为此:

["Type 1","Type 2","Type 3"]

即没有重复的和“名称”属性。

非常感谢任何建议。

最佳答案

_(data).chain().flatten().pluck('name').unique().value()

(将嵌套列表转换为平面列表,从列表中的每个对象中选择名称,并使其唯一。)

关于javascript - Underscore.js - 获取唯一的属性值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21557431/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com